Understanding Student Loans for International Students in the UK
International students in the UK often find themselves in a financial conundrum. Unlike domestic students, they generally do not have access to UK government student loans. However, various private lenders and alternative financing options can help bridge the gap. Understanding these options is crucial to successfully funding your education.
Available Loan Options and Eligibility Criteria
When considering student loans in the UK, international students can explore several private lenders and specific international student loan programs. Below is a breakdown of current options, typical interest rates, and eligibility criteria.
| Lender | Interest Rate | Eligibility Criteria |
|---|---|---|
| Prodigy Finance | 7.5% - 9.5% | Enrolled in a partner university, postgraduate courses |
| Future Finance | 9.4% - 12% | Undergraduate and postgraduate, credit check required |
| MPower Financing | 6.49% - 10.99% | No co-signer, US/Canada universities only |
These lenders cater specifically to international students, offering loans that do not require a UK credit history or a local co-signer, which can be a significant advantage.
Steps to Secure a Student Loan as an International Student
Securing a student loan involves several critical steps. Here's how you can navigate the process:
- Research and Compare: Begin by researching various lenders. Compare interest rates, repayment terms, and eligibility criteria.
- Check Eligibility: Ensure that you meet the lender's requirements, such as being enrolled in a specific course or having an offer from a partner university.
- Prepare Documentation: Gather necessary documents, including proof of enrolment, passport, and financial statements.
- Apply for the Loan: Complete the application process, which typically involves an online form. Be prepared for a possible credit check.
- Review Loan Offer: Once approved, review the loan offer carefully. Pay attention to the interest rate, repayment terms, and any fees.
- Accept and Sign: If satisfied with the terms, accept the loan and sign the agreement.
- Receive Funds: Funds are usually disbursed directly to the university to cover tuition fees, with any remaining balance provided to you for living expenses.

Frequently Asked Questions
1. Can I get a UK government student loan as an international student?
No, UK government student loans are not available to international students. However, private lenders offer alternative options.
2. Do I need a co-signer for a private student loan?
Some lenders, like MPower Financing, do not require a co-signer, making them an attractive option for international students.
3. What is the typical interest rate for international student loans?
Interest rates vary but generally range from 6.49% to 12% depending on the lender and your qualifications.
4. How can I improve my chances of getting a loan?
Ensure you meet all eligibility criteria, prepare strong documentation, and apply early to improve your chances.
